Tech Parenthesis

Python & SQL Online Training – B09 – 10th Dec 2024

4 Enrolled No ratings yet All Levels

Course Duration : 2 Months (60+ Hours of Live Sessions

 About Course

This course is for those who want to learn python for software development, web development and data analysis. If you don’t have fundamental knowledge of python, you cannot start software development, web development and data analysis.

Python is a free and open source programming language that is really easy to learn. Python is used in many applications and it has a potential of generating jobs.  You should start learning python today.

Module I: Core Python Programming

  • Introduction of Python Programming
  • Installing Python – Python IDLE, Jupyter Notebook and Google Colab
  • Writing Your First Python Program
  • Data-types in Python
  • Variables in Python – Declaration and Use
  • Typecasting in Python
  • Operators in Python –Arithmetic, Comparison, Logical , Assignment, Identity, Membership operators
  • Taking User Input (Console)
  • Conditional Statements – If else and Nested If else and elif
  • Loops in Python – For Loop, While Loop & Nested Loops
  • Python Collections (Arrays) – List, Tuple, Sets and Dictionary
  • String Manipulation – Basic Operations, Slicing & Functions and Methods
  • User Defined Functions – Defining, Calling, Types of Functions, Arguments, Recursion
  • Lambda Function
  • Importing Modules – Math / Time / Statistics / Calendar Module

 

Module II: Object Oriented Programming using Python

  • Basics of Object Oriented Programming
  • Creating Class and Object
  • In built class methods and attributes
  • Constructors in Python – Parameterized and Non-parameterized
  • Inheritance in Python, Types of inheritance, Single / Multi-level / Multiple / Hybrid / Hierarchical
  • Method Overriding/Overloading and Data Abstraction
  • Encapsulation and Polymorphism
  • Exception Handling

 Module III: Python Libraries 

  • What is function and need of using Python library
  • Data Analysis Libraries in Python such as NumPy (for scientific computing ) and Pandas for (data analysis / data manipulation)
  • Data Visualization Libraries in Python such as Matplotlib for creating line plots , bar plots, pie charts, scatter plots and histogram

 Module IV: MySQL

  • Introduction to DBMS (Data Base Management System)
  • Need and Importance of DBMS and concept of RDBMS
  • Introduction to SQL Language
  • Installation of MySQL 8.0 software / Online SQL editors
  • Introduction to SQL data types
  • Commands in SQL
  • Operators and Functions of SQL
  • Types and usage of integrity constraints in SQL
  • MySQL Workbench
  • User Management like create user / drop user / show users / change user password
  • Sub queries/ Stored procedures in SQL
  • Joins and Views in SQL
  • MySQL connectors
  • Interview Questions and Assignments
  • Online Examinations

For More Information Contact

+91 94411 64602

+91 95779 81999

Whatsapp

+91 95779 81999

Email : TechParenthesis@gmail.com

 

Show More
5,000.00
Incl. Tax
MM Chowdary

MM Chowdary

5.0Instructor Rating
14
Students
5
Courses
2
Reviews
View Details
Log in/Sign up with Google account for password less login.

Or

Login with your email & password

Sign up with your Google account for password less login.

Or

Sign up with your email & password

Signup/Registration Form